AEW International Champion Jon Moxley has revealed what Vince McMahon said to him in their last conversation with one another.
While Moxley gained a lot of popularity in WWE as ‘Dean Ambrose’, the former WWE Champion has arguably had the run of his career since leaving in 2019, winning gold in AEW, NJPW, and a number of independent promotions.
Moxley most recently won gold at All Out 2023, defeating Orange Cassidy to win the AEW International Title.
Speaking with Bleav Pro Wrestling, Jon Moxley noted that in his last conversation with Vince McMahon, the former WWE owner told Moxley that he took him for granted.
Moxley noted:
“I take a lot of pride in our work and our work ethic and the standard we set ourselves to, and the way we do the job. To be one of those guys that’s reliable, that’s always there, the downside is that it’s very easy to take you for granted.
“The last conversation I had with Vince McMahon, he straight up told me, we took you for granted.
“It is a tough job because I got a lot of experience, a lot of stuff is very familiar to me and I’m comfortable doing stuff that a lot of other people may be intimated by.”
